Output d6e83ee850341fcd3bbb9c4eccdff60a183bdfd3c181482363aad87bd5d084ba:1

value
6152812
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03ea4c7b6ec8eef81ae85f8ec2824886951ab62d OP_EQUAL
address
323idUvyJ5A4nvFcLx11vCRJvcFByqdJ8S
transaction
d6e83ee850341fcd3bbb9c4eccdff60a183bdfd3c181482363aad87bd5d084ba
confirmations
350703
spent
true